For the application year 2024, the University of New Mexico boasts an overall acceptance rate of 75.8%, with 15,860 applicants and 12,029 accepted. The domestic acceptance rate stands at 77.5%, while the international rate is lower at 73.5%. Historically, the acceptance rate for 2021 was 57.8%, highlighting a significant increase in acceptance in recent years. The university maintains a transfer acceptance rate of 75.8% with an average GPA of 3.4, showcasing a welcoming approach to transfer students. SAT scores for admitted students range from a 25th percentile of 910 to a 75th percentile of 1110, indicating varying levels of academic preparedness among applicants.
